Lunar Cycle Rituals and Moon Mapping

Lunar Cycle Rituals and Moon Mapping (Image Credits: Unsplash)

The moon has always held mystical allure, yet now its phases are being harnessed for tangible wellness benefits. Whereas new moons are a time to set intentions, full moons are a window for release, clarity and illumination. People are planning their entire months around these cycles.

Moon phase meditation has become a popular practice, with individuals aligning their intentions and reflections with lunar cycles. Picture lighting candles during the new moon to journal your goals, then burning what no longer serves you under the full moon’s glow. Studies have shown journaling can help reduce symptoms of anxiety and depression, improve memory and even boost immunity, making these rituals doubly beneficial.

It’s hard to say for sure, but the rhythm of the moon seems to offer people an anchor in our chaotic modern lives.

Astrological Aromatherapy Pairings

Astrological Aromatherapy Pairings (Image Credits: Unsplash)

Essential oils meet zodiac signs in this surprisingly harmonious pairing. Astrology-based aromatherapy has gained popularity, with specific essential oils associated with different zodiac signs. For example, lavender is linked to Pisces, while peppermint is connected to Gemini. The idea is to use scents that resonate with your sign’s elemental energy.

Fire signs might gravitate toward invigorating citrus blends, while water signs find comfort in calming florals. This practice adds another sensory layer to self-care, transforming a simple diffuser into a cosmic wellness tool. Some practitioners even adjust their aromatherapy based on planetary transits, switching scents when Mercury goes retrograde or Venus enters a new sign.

Planetary Sound Healing and Vibrational Therapy

Planetary Sound Healing and Vibrational Therapy (Image Credits: Unsplash)

Here’s where things get really interesting. Sound healing has merged with astrology to create planetary frequency therapy. Cousto had discovered the mathematical formula for calculating the precise frequencies of planetary movement and how to express those frequencies as musical notes. Something that had been only theorised all the way back to the days of Plato. Practitioners use crystal singing bowls tuned to specific planetary frequencies.

Sound healing in astrology encompasses multiple approaches each designed to address specific planetary impacts & energy imbalances. One common method is the use of musical instruments such as crystal bowls gongs & tuning forks which match to particular planets or zodiac signs. Imagine lying in a sound bath where the instruments correspond to your Venus placement for heart healing or your Mercury for communication clarity. Individuals practicing sound healing alongside astrological guidance often report improved mental clarity deeper meditation experiences & a sense of inner harmony.

Generational Astrology and Collective Healing

Generational Astrology and Collective Healing (Image Credits: Pixabay)

The newest frontier combines personal and collective healing through generational astrology. Each generation shares outer planet placements that shape their collective experiences and challenges. Understanding these shared cosmic signatures helps people contextualize their personal struggles within larger societal patterns.

Millennials share Pluto in Scorpio, giving context to their generation’s fascination with depth, transformation, and exposing hidden truths. Gen Z’s Pluto in Sagittarius speaks to their quest for meaning and global perspective. Practitioners are creating group healing spaces organized around these generational placements, recognizing that individual wellness is inseparable from collective healing. It’s a reminder that we’re all under the same sky, navigating the same cosmic weather together.
